Hotter Brewing Technology
The coffee comes out hotter than with other machines I’ve used.
The machine saturates the grounds evenly and keeps the right temperature during brewing. This process brings out the coffee’s flavor.
The hotter brew might be too hot for some people’s first sip, so I suggest being careful.
Programmable Delay Brew and Freshness Timer
I set the machine to start brewing up to 24 hours in advance.
Waking up to fresh coffee felt nice.
The freshness timer shows when the last pot was made. This helped me avoid drinking coffee that sat too long on the warming plate.
Variable Warming Plate
The warming plate keeps coffee hot for up to four hours.
I liked having three temperature levels so I could pick the heat that suited me best.
After a few hours, the taste changes a bit, so I don’t use it to keep coffee fresh all day.
Removable Water Reservoir
The water tank holds a good amount and is easy to carry to the sink for refilling.
Its size means I make a full 14-cup pot or multiple small batches with fewer trips.
The tank feels a bit bulky when full, so I handle it carefully to avoid spills.
Pros and Cons
After using this coffee maker, I noticed some clear advantages and a few drawbacks.
Pros
The large 14-cup capacity works well when I make coffee for several people without refilling.
The classic and rich brew options let me adjust the taste based on how strong I want my coffee.
The small batch feature makes sure my smaller brews don’t taste weak or watered down.
The built-in delay brew and freshness timer help me plan ahead and know how old the coffee is.
The warming plate with different heat settings keeps my coffee at the right temperature for hours without burning it.
The removable water reservoir makes refilling much easier than some other models I’ve tried.
Cons
The carafe feels a bit fragile, so I handle it carefully to avoid cracks or breaks.
Sometimes the machine gives error messages, so I need to troubleshoot or wait longer between brews.
I need to use the right type of paper filters, since 12-cup filters don’t fit well and can cause messes.
The brew time feels slow if I want to make back-to-back pots.
If I want to use it outside of the US, I need an adapter for the plug.
